Frequently asked questions

What is 3135 GODWIN TERRACE's energy grade?

3135 GODWIN TERRACE scores 100 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band A (High performer (85–100)) — in its 2024 New York City dis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.

How much energy does 3135 GODWIN TERRACE use?

Its 2024 site energy-use intensity was 13.7 kBtu/ft² (32.8 kBtu/ft² source) across 69,500 sq ft, including 213,570 kWh of electricity and 2,258 therms of natural gas.

What are 3135 GODWIN TERRACE's carbon emissions?

3135 GODWIN TERRACE reported 96 tCO₂e of greenhouse-gas emissions (1.4 kgCO₂e/ft²) for 2024. Under Local Law 97, buildings over 25,000 sq ft face carbon caps with fines of $268 per metric ton of CO₂e over the limit, phasing in from 2024.
